The best thing that has happened to me this year (reading-wise) is definitely stumbling upon John Marrs and his novels. This is the fourth book of his that I have read and I was not disappointed. While his other titles may have more of a science fiction aspect to them, this story proves that Marrs can write a really great psychological thriller, as well. I am continued to be impressed with his storytelling ability and will read literally anything he puts out in the future. (I know this review is very short, but I can't give much of a summary without giving away essential plot points. Just trust me on this one - you're going to want to read it!)
